Brian Mielke went 2-for-3 with a double and an RBI as the Mariners slipped past the Cardinals 11-9 in a Gastineau Channel Little League game on Saturday at Miller Field.
Andrew Williamson and Mielke pitched in the win. Also, Williamson went 1-for-3 with two runs scored.
For the Cardinals, Hunter Miller had two doubles and an RBI while Kaleb Tompkins had a base hit and two runs scored. Stefan Jones, Curtis Stickler, Nathan Klein and Tompkins all pitched in defeat.
MAJOR BASEBALL
Braves 2, Angels 1
The Braves' Adam Empson and Tod Baseden combined to limit the Angels to one run in a win on Saturday.
Gus Swanton and Kenny Fox pitched for the Angels.
Phillies 11, Braves 7
The Phillies rallied from a six-run deficit to down the Braves on Thursday.
George Grummett aided the rally with a two-run home run.
Grummett, Ryan Lee and Grant Ainsworth pitched for the Phillies while R.J. Markovich, Tod Baseden and Dennis Barril took the ball for the Braves.
Mariners 5, Athletics 4
Jake Macaulay's RBI single drove in Andrew Williamson with the go-ahead run as the Mariners upended the Athletics on Thursday.
For the Mariners, Dustin Rumfelt went 2-for-3 with two doubles, two runs scored and an RBI. Brian Mielke, Nick Stewart and Rumfelt all pitched in the win.
Jackson Pavitt hit two triples and score a run, Tal Norvell hit an RBI double and Collin Ludeman hit a solo home-run in the loss. Norvell and Ludeman pitched in defeat.
Cardinals 11, Angels 2
Tanner Petrie and Kaleb Tompkins pitched in the Cardinals' win over the Angels on Thursday.
Phillies 4, Mariners 1
Jeryd Schauwecker scored twice and had a base hit for the Phillies on Tuesday.
Jared Markovich allowed two hits and struck out seven batters in the win while George Grummett added two innings of shutout relief.
Andrew Williamson and Brian Mielke pitched for the M's.
Cardinals 12, Braves 6
Nathan Klein, Stephen Jones and Kaleb Tompkins pitched in the win on Tuesday.
R.J. Markovich, Tod Baseden, Jasper McNaugton and Dennis Barril all pitched in defeat.
MAJOR SOFTBALL
RipTide 16, Reign 7
Kayla Balovich hit a three-run triple while Heather Alducin and Savanna Schauwecker hit home runs in the RipTide's win over the Reign on Saturday.
For the Reign, Racheal Doogan scored twice and Bailey Davenport had two hits.
RipTide 10, Reign 3
Savanna Schauwecker pitched a complete game and Heather Alducin hit a grand slam to pace the RipTide past the Reign on Saturday.
Brittney Browne added a two-run single and two runs scored in the win.
Breanne Chapman scored twice for the Reign.
RipTide 12, Crush 11
Jodi Mesdag scored the game-winning run in the RipTide's triumph over the Crush on Thursday.
Savanna Schauwecker turned a double play and relief pitcher Sierra Westika earned the win for the Rip Tide.
For the Crush, Gracie Meiners hit a three-run triple while Megan Punongbayan and Hannah Finochio added base hits.
